Ingredients
- 1 1/2 pounds boneless pork chops, cut into 3/4-inch cubes
- 1 cup broccoli, chopped
- 2 cups carrots, sliced
- 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
- 1/3 cup green onions, finely ch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 1/2 cups white sauce *, premade or homemade
- 12 ounces bow tie pasta, cooked (about 5 1/2 cups)
- 1/3 cup Parmesan cheese, grated
- 2 large tomatoes, diced
- 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ped
- salt and pepper, to taste
- White Sauce:
- 3 tablespoons butter
- 3 cups milk
- 3 tablespoons flour
- 1/3 cup Parmesan cheese, grated
Instructions
- Place broccoli and carrots in medium saucepan; add about one inch of water. Cook over medium-high heat until tender. Drain; set aside.
- Heat oil in large skillet over medium-high heat until hot. Add pork, green onions, and garlic; cook 10 to 15 minutes, or until pork is no longer pink.
- Prepare White Sauce if not using purchased. Melt butter in small saucepan over medium heat. Blend flour and milk; add to saucepan. Cook, stirring constantly until mixture is smooth and creamy. Stir in cheese.
- Combine pasta, pork mixture, vegetables and white sauce in large casserole dish. Top with Parmesan cheese, tomatoes, parsley, salt and pepper. Toss and serve.
